2013 Undergraduate Transfer Student Scholarship
A limited number of undergraduate transfer* student scholarships will be awarded to transfer students that have a financial need based on their FAFSA and also meet the following criteria:
Scholarship amount is $500. Award will be disbursed half for 2013 fall semester and half for 2014 spring semester.A separate application is not required to be considered for this scholarship. Students need only to complete and submit their FAFSA at www.fafsa.gov. Students who receive the award will be notified by mail, e-mail and as part of their financial aid package in late June.
* a transfer student is defined as a student that has taken college courses beginning with the fall semester after they graduated from high school.
This scholarship is offered only to qualified students transferring directly from two-year colleges.
STEM Stars Scholarships [PDF]
Scholarships will be awarded to freshmen and transfer students in the Applied Science program. Recipients will be awarded a maximum of $5,000 or their FAFSA estimated “financial need,” whichever is less. This scholarship is not renewable. Applicants must demonstrate academic promise and commitment to Applied Science. For more information, contact Dr. Kitrina Carlson, 715-232-1248 or carlsonki@uwstout.edu or visit the website.
